Analysis

In 2023, agricultural land in Guam stood at 29.6%. That is the lowest value across all 63 years on record.

That represents a change of down 11.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, agricultural land in Guam peaked at 37.0% in 1981 and was at its lowest, 29.6%, in 1961.

That places Guam 127th out of 210 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the middle of the range.

Agricultural land refers to the share of land area that is arable, under permanent crops, and under permanent pastures. Arable land includes land defined by the FAO as land under temporary crops (double-cropped areas are counted once), temporary meadows for mowing or for pasture, land under market or kitchen gardens, and land temporarily fallow. Land abandoned as a result of shifting cultivation is excluded. Land under permanent crops is land cultivated with crops that occupy the land for long periods and need not be replanted after each harvest, such as cocoa, coffee, and rubber. This category includes land under flowering shrubs, fruit trees, nut trees, and vines, but excludes land under trees grown for wood or timber. Permanent pasture is land used for five or more years for forage, including natural and cultivated crops.
